Rogers OMNI releases production benefits package details
Rogers OMNI Television has unveiled details of its $950,000 benefits package for independent documentary production in British Columbia and Manitoba over seven years. A maximum of $250,000 will be spent each year, with proposals being reviewed twice a year: January 1 to March 1, and September 1 to November 15. The money will go toward the creation of 30-minute and 60-minute religious and faith-based documentaries. The benefits package relates to Rogers’ purchase of NOWTV (CHNU-TV Fraser Valley), now called OMNI TV BC, and the launch of CIIT-TV Winnipeg, referred to as OMNI TV Manitoba (CCR, June 8/05).
